Literature summary for 6.1.1.20 extracted from

  • Savopoulos, J.W.; Hibbs, M.; Jones, E.J.; Mensah, L.; Richardson, C.; Fosberry, A.; Downes, R.; Fox, S.G.; Brown, J.R.; Jenkins, O.
    Identification, cloning, and expression of a functional phenylalanyl-tRNA synthetase (pheRS) from Staphylococcus aureus (2001), Protein Expr. Purif., 21, 470-484.
    View publication on PubMed

Cloned(Commentary)

Cloned (Comment) Organism
genes pheS and pheT encoding the alpha and beta subunits in one transcriptional operon, DNA and amino acid sequence determination and analysis, overexpression of both genes in an artificial operon in Escherichia coli Staphylococcus aureus

Molecular Weight [Da]

Molecular Weight [Da] Molecular Weight Maximum [Da] Comment Organism
40000
-
alpha-subunit of recombinant enzyme, mass spectroscopy Staphylococcus aureus
89090
-
beta-subunit of recombinant enzyme, mass spectroscopy Staphylococcus aureus
90000
-
2 * 40000, alpha subunit, + 2 * 90000, beta-subunit, (alphabeta)2, recombinant enzyme, SDS-PAGE Staphylococcus aureus
